How can I evaluate something that I agree with?

Evaluation does not mean having to disprove or negate the point you have made. Some points do not have a logical opposite. However, you do not need to say whether or not the fiscal policy would increase consumption but rather answer three simple questions;

1. How long will it take to implement/come into effect?

2. How large an effect will it have?

3. Is there another policy that would be more effective?
